The correct answer is Option (3) → the total flux through the closed surface is zero. $\int\limits_sE.dA=0$ is a consequence of the total that there are no net electric charges enclosed by the surface, is zero. Therefore, the amount of flux entering the surface is equal to the amount of flux leaving the surface. |
